آموزش ساخت پورت اسکنر با زبان سی شارپ همراه با ویدئو
با یکی دیگر از مقالات و آموزش های ویدئویی تیم بلک سکوریتی خدمت شما کاربران محترم هستیم.
در این پست قصد داریم به ساخت پورت اسکنر با زبان سی شارپ (همراه با ویدئوی آموزشی ساخت پورت اسکنر) بپردازیم..
- نکته : پیشنهاد میکنیم قبل از تماشای ویدئو بالا ابتدا مطالب زیر را مطالعه فرمایید.
نیم نگاهی به پورت چیست ؟ به زبان ساده
Port به معنای یک درگاه است. یعنی دری که اجازه ورود به داخل یا بیرون یک سرور یا کلاینت رو میدهد.
خیال کنید که شما قصد دارید به خانه یکی از اقوامتون بروید. خب برای رفتن به خانه اقوامتون با آدرس آن خانه را داشته باشید که در شبکه کامپیوتری به معنای همان آی پی آدرس مقصد است. حال برای آنکه بتوانید به داخل خانه بروید باید پس از پیدا کردن آن خانه از طریق درب وارد خانه بشوید. که درب خانه در شبکه های کامپیوتری به معنای همان Port است.
پورت اسکنر
Port Scanner ها ابزارهایی برای بررسی وضعیت یک پورت در یک سرور هستند. در این حالت متخصص امنیت به ابزار پورت اسکنر یک ای پی میدهد و این ابزار بررسی میکند که پورت های سرور در چه حالتی قرار دارند. آیا باز هستند یا بسته یا فیلتر..
خب این بررسی چه کمکی به ما میکند ؟
در هر پورت در یک سرور یک سرویس اجرا شده. یا یک مسیر ارتباطی با سرور است.
پس با دانستن پورت های باز یک سرور می توان با توجه به سرویس اجرا شده در آن پورت یک سناریو تست نفوذ برای بررسی امنیت آن پورت طراحی کرد. و بررسی کنیم که آیا آن پورت دارای آسیب پذیری خاصی هست که یک هکر بتوان از طریف آن آسیب پذیری به آن نفوذ کند یا نه !
ساخت پورت اسکنر با سی شارپ
با توجه به توضیحات بالا در این پست قصد داریم با استفاده از زبان برنامه نویسی C-Sharp اقدام به کد نویسی یک پورت اسکنر سی شارپی کنیم. پس شما را دعوت به تماشای ویدیو بالا میکنم.